Channel Islands Harbor is excited to welcome the community to the 27th Annual Celebration of the Whales Festival, taking place from 11 a.m. to 3 p.m. on Sunday, April 19, 2026.

A beloved Harbor tradition, this free, family-friendly event celebrates the incredible migration of the Pacific Gray Whale with a full day of interactive activities, education, and ocean-inspired fun.

This year’s festival will feature a community art project, colorful chalk art, shopping, a children’s fun zone, and more. Activities will take place at the Channel Islands Maritime Museum, Channel Islands Boating Center, the Harbor Farmers Market, and along the popular “Gray Whale Migration Trail” through Harbor View Park, connecting the event’s main activity hubs.

Harbor View Park: Family Fun, Art & Whale Education

Families can explore the Gray Whale Migration Trail, featuring interactive and educational booths about the Pacific Gray Whale, along with more than 15 ocean-themed chalk art installations.

Harbor View Park will also host:

  • A Children’s Fun Zone with bounce houses and carnival games
  • A community mural project, open to all ages
  • Engaging marine education experiences for kids and adults alike

The art project will once again be facilitated by the Oxnard Performing Arts Center Corporation.

Channel Islands Maritime Museum & Channel Islands Boating Center

At the Channel Islands Maritime Museum, guests can enjoy hands-on activities celebrating whales and marine life, including:

  • Interactive experiments
  • Boat building and knot tying
  • Arts, crafts, contests, and prizes

Outdoor activities are free, and the museum will be open to visitors (children receive free admission with a paid adult). Food trucks will also be on site.

At the Channel Islands Boating Center, attendees can visit a student market featuring California State University Channel Islands (CSUCI) entrepreneurs, showcasing small businesses run by local students. A selection of local nonprofit organizations will also be on-site, sharing information about their programs and community initiatives.

In addition, the Boating Center’s dock area will be open to the public for tours and learning opportunities, offering visitors a chance to explore the waterfront up close and learn more about boating and ocean recreation.

Channel Islands Harbor Farmers Market

The Harbor Farmers Market will feature:

  • An arts & crafts marketplace
  • Children’s activities
  • Whale facts and marine education booths

The Celebration of the Whales Festival is a collaborative event among Harbor partners, local businesses, and the Harbor Department, bringing the community together to honor the annual migration of the Pacific Gray Whale in a fun, engaging, and family-friendly setting.
